The given graphs are straight line graphs.

The equation of a straight line can be represented in the slope-intercept form, y = mx + c

Where c = intercept

Slope, m =change in value of y on the vertical axis / change in value of x on the horizontal axis

change in the value of y = y2 - y1

Change in value of x = x2 -x1

The given equation is

- 5y = - 6x + 15

Rearranging the equation so that it will look like y = mx + c, it becomes

y = 6x/5 -3

The slope, m = 6/5

Looking at the graphs, the slope of graph c is 6/5. This is determined by picking corresponding points

(y2 - y1)/(x2-x1) = (3 - - 3)/(5 - 0) = 6/5
